When I open “KEY EDITOR”/“SAMPLE EDITOR” and edit sounds MIDI/WAV etc … key on the keyboard “M” (responsible for mute) does not work - the track can still hear (?)
In earlier versions of Cubase everything worked - key “M” was responsible for silencing the corresponding track recording and it functioned!

Sorry, maybe I wasn’t clear. Yes, it cannot work. If the KeyEditor/Sample Editor is open, and the focus is in the editor, then it doesn’t work. To make it work, you have to make Project Window or MixConsole window active (in focus). So click to the Project window/MixConsole first. Then press M Key Command.
Also make sure, the M Key Commands is assign to the Mute function, please.
